CrawlJobs Logo
Briefcase Icon
Category Icon

Software Engineer - Automation/ Python Jobs

67 Job Offers

Filters
Python Software Engineer
Save Icon
Join NTT DATA's Security DevOps team in Bucharest as a Senior Python Software Engineer. Develop scalable, secure backend systems using modern Python frameworks like FastAPI and Flask. You will ensure performance and compliance while working with cloud platforms, CI/CD, and containerization. This ...
Location Icon
Location
Romania , Bucuresti
Salary Icon
Salary
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Python Software Engineer with LLM (Principal)
Save Icon
Join a new internal startup as a Principal Python Engineer with LLM expertise. Design and build an intelligent AI platform to revolutionize developer experience for thousands. Integrate cutting-edge LLMs and AI agents into core workflows using Python. Enjoy a hybrid model from Kielce, Kraków, or ...
Location Icon
Location
Poland , Kielce; Kraków; Wrocław
Salary Icon
Salary
30000.00 - 37000.00 PLN / Month
virtuslab.com Logo
VirtusLab
Expiration Date
Until further notice
Python Software Engineer with LLM
Save Icon
Join a new internal startup as a Python Software Engineer with LLM expertise. Design and build an intelligent AI platform to revolutionize developer workflows. Integrate cutting-edge LLMs and agent-based systems into tools like GitHub and IDEs. Enjoy a hybrid model in Kielce, Kraków, or Wrocław w...
Location Icon
Location
Poland , Kielce; Kraków; Wrocław
Salary Icon
Salary
26000.00 - 31000.00 PLN / Month
virtuslab.com Logo
VirtusLab
Expiration Date
Until further notice
Python Principal Software Engineer
Save Icon
Lead the technical vision for FreeWheel's Programmatic Demand platform as a Principal Software Engineer. This senior role requires 15+ years of experience building scalable distributed systems in Python/C++/Java/Go within the ad-tech/media industry. You will architect core features, mentor engine...
Location Icon
Location
United States , Chicago; Denver
Salary Icon
Salary
180337.97 - 277420.95 USD / Year
comcastadvertising.com Logo
Comcast Advertising
Expiration Date
Until further notice
Sr. Software Engineer - ReactJS + Python
Save Icon
Join our Pune team as a Senior Software Engineer, specializing in ReactJS and Python. You will design robust REST APIs with Django/FastAPI and build dynamic UIs with React/Redux. We seek strong full-stack skills in Python, databases, testing, and DevOps. Enjoy flexible work, a positive culture, a...
Location Icon
Location
India , Pune
Salary Icon
Salary
Not provided
yash.com Logo
YASH TECHNOLOGIES CONSULTING INC.
Expiration Date
Until further notice
Senior Python Software Engineer
Save Icon
Join our remote-first team as a Senior Python Backend Engineer in Brno or Prague. Take ownership of critical analytics systems, working with Python, MongoDB, Redis, and Kafka. Enjoy great freedom, flexible hours, a professional development budget, and a supportive, collaborative environment.
Location Icon
Location
Czechia , Brno; Prague
Salary Icon
Salary
Not provided
bloomreach.com Logo
Bloomreach
Expiration Date
Until further notice
Senior Python Software Engineer
Save Icon
Join our team as a Senior Python Software Engineer in Bratislava. Take ownership of complex, business-critical backend systems for our analytics platform, handling large-scale data. We seek experts in Python, MongoDB, Redis, and distributed systems. Enjoy a virtual-first culture with flexible hou...
Location Icon
Location
Slovakia , Bratislava
Salary Icon
Salary
4000.00 EUR / Month
bloomreach.com Logo
Bloomreach
Expiration Date
Until further notice

About the Software Engineer - Automation/ Python role

Explore the dynamic world of Software Engineer - Automation/Python jobs, a specialized career path at the intersection of software development, process optimization, and intelligent system creation. Professionals in this field leverage the power and versatility of Python to design, build, and maintain systems that automate complex tasks, streamline operations, and drive efficiency across various industries. This role is central to modern digital transformation, focusing on replacing manual, repetitive workflows with reliable, scalable, and intelligent software solutions.

A Software Engineer specializing in Automation and Python typically engages in a wide array of responsibilities. Core to the role is analyzing existing business or technical processes to identify automation opportunities. They then architect and develop robust software applications, scripts, and frameworks to execute these processes automatically. This involves writing clean, maintainable, and efficient Python code, often utilizing libraries and frameworks specifically designed for automation, web scraping, data processing, and task scheduling. A significant part of the job is integrating disparate systems through APIs, designing and consuming RESTful services to enable seamless data flow and functionality between applications. For roles with an AI/ML focus, responsibilities extend to building, training, and deploying machine learning models, developing pipelines for data processing, and creating intelligent agents or chatbots using frameworks for natural language processing and generative AI.

Beyond pure automation, these engineers are often responsible for the entire development lifecycle. They design scalable backend services and microservices, frequently deploying them on cloud platforms like AWS, Azure, or GCP using containerization technologies like Docker and orchestration tools like Kubernetes. They collaborate closely with cross-functional teams, including product managers, DevOps engineers, and data scientists, to deliver end-to-end solutions. Common tasks also include conducting code reviews, optimizing application performance, writing comprehensive tests, and maintaining thorough documentation. They are expected to stay current with emerging technologies, frameworks, and best practices in both the Python ecosystem and the automation landscape.

The typical skill set for these jobs is both deep and broad. Proficiency in Python is fundamental, with expected knowledge of key libraries such as Pandas, NumPy, Requests, and frameworks like Flask or Django for web development. A strong grasp of software engineering principles—data structures, algorithms, object-oriented design, and design patterns—is essential. Experience with version control systems, particularly Git, is a standard requirement. As solutions are often cloud-native, familiarity with cloud services, infrastructure-as-code, and CI/CD pipelines is highly valued. For automation-specific roles, knowledge of tools like Selenium, Celery, or Airflow is beneficial, while AI-focused positions require expertise in ML libraries (e.g., TensorFlow, PyTorch), vector databases, and LLM orchestration tools. Soft skills such as problem-solving, analytical thinking, and effective communication are crucial for translating business needs into technical specifications and successful automation jobs.

Ultimately, pursuing Software Engineer - Automation/Python jobs means embarking on a career dedicated to building the intelligent backbone of modern enterprises. It is ideal for those who enjoy solving complex problems, have a passion for efficiency and innovation, and want to create software that works autonomously to deliver tangible business value. The demand for these skills continues to grow as organizations across all sectors seek to harness automation and data-driven intelligence.

Filters

×
Countries
Category
Location
Work Mode
Salary